1 QUEENS ROAD is a very small detached house of 91m², built sometime between 1930 and 1949, which could now be worth an estimated £595,886. It was last sold for £590,000 in June 2022, which was around 34% below the average June 2022 detached price in the Reigate and Banstead local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2022, where the current energy rating was F, and the potential energy rating was E.

What might 1 QUEENS ROAD be worth now?

1 QUEENS ROAD might now be worth an estimated £595,886.

This is based on house price inflation of 1%, between June 2022 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Reigate and Banstead local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 1 QUEENS ROAD of £590,000 on 29th June 2022. For the value to have increased from £590,000 to £595,886 over the three years and four months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 1 QUEENS 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Reigate and Banstead local authority area.
  • The June 2022 sale price of £590,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 1 QUEENS ROAD has not materially changed since June 2022.
